The woodworking course was created to help you deepen your knowledge. In this 6 session course, you will carry out a complex project, and discover everything to become autonomous.

In Level 1, you will learn about all the machines and then make a stool/stepladder.

Through the 6 sessions, you will see:

  • The planer, jointer, bench saw
  • The miter saw, scroll saw, band saw, drill press
  • The gluing techniques
  • The wood and its applied technical properties
  • The art of finishing, products, and techniques

In addition to the 6 sessions, the Wood Course gives you free access to 8 hours of workshop time, to work on your project between sessions.

The evening sessions are held once a week, over 6 consecutive weeks – on the same day at the same time.
